My name is Erwin Koning, I’m 43 years old, married and proud father of four boys. I’m a Field Service Engineer at Qimarox. It’s a great job where you’re often on the road to install new product lifts, maintain and overhaul and modify or optimise existing lifts. For this type of work, you really must be stress resistant, inventive/creative and above all, flexible. Luckily, I don’t suffer from stress, am very inventive and very flexible.
Qimarox is a great company, where everyone deals with each other in a fun, informal way. We’re growing enormously now. We have many customers in Europe, but also far beyond. I just completed two projects in America. On both projects I placed three Prorunner mk5 lifts of different sizes. The largest is over 11 meters high! Thanks to the good cooperation with the integrator, these projects were completed with a good result.
